- Package &1 does not allow transportation ?The SAP error message ESH_CU_SW020 indicates that a specific package (denoted by &1) is not allowed for transportation. This typically occurs in the context of SAP's transport management system (TMS) when you attempt to transport objects that are part of a package that has been configured to be non-transportable.
Cause: Package Configuration: The package in question has been set to "local" or "non-transportable." This is often done for development packages that are intended to remain in the development environment and not be moved to production or other systems. Transport Layer Settings: The transport layer associated with the package may also be configured to restrict transport. Object Type Restrictions: Certain object types within the package may have restrictions that prevent them from being transported.
